In the ever-evolving world of kitchen appliances, built-in ceramic cooktops have emerged as one of the most sought-after features in modern kitchens. These stylish and functional cooktops not only elevate the aesthetic appeal of culinary spaces but also offer impressive performance that can enhance cooking experiences.

One of the primary reasons homeowners gravitate toward built-in ceramic cooktops is their seamless integration into the kitchen design. Unlike traditional freestanding ranges, built-in models allow for a more uniform look, eliminating bulky appliances that can disrupt the flow of a well-designed space. This sleek design not only saves space but also provides an impression of elegance and sophistication, making it a popular choice among homeowners looking to upgrade their kitchens.

From a functional standpoint, ceramic cooktops boast an array of benefits that make them a top contender in the kitchen appliance market. The smooth surface of these cooktops, typically made of glazed ceramic, provides an easy-to-clean cooking area. Spills and splatters can be wiped away effortlessly, saving you valuable time during meal prep and cleanup. Furthermore, many ceramic cooktops feature indicators that visibly alert users when surfaces are hot, enhancing safety for families with children.

Temperature control is another significant advantage of built-in ceramic cooktops. With advanced technology, many models offer precise temperature settings that allow for consistent cooking results. Whether you’re simmering delicate sauces or boiling pasta, the ability to easily adjust heat levels ensures your meals are cooked to perfection. Additionally, some cooktops include features such as rapid boil and warming zones, catering to a diverse range of cooking styles.

For those conscious of energy consumption, ceramic cooktops can also provide an efficient cooking experience. They utilize electric heating elements that quickly transfer heat to pots and pans, reducing cooking time and energy expenditure. This eco-friendly option can lead to substantial savings on utility bills over time, making it an attractive choice for both budget-conscious homeowners and those wanting to minimize their environmental footprint.

When considering a built-in ceramic cooktop, it’s crucial to explore the various options available on the market. Consumers can choose from models that come equipped with advanced features like touch controls, digital displays, and even smart technology that allows for remote operation via smartphones. Brands often compete to provide robust warranties and customer service, making it easier for potential buyers to find the perfect product that suits their cooking habits and lifestyle.

It's essential to factor in the style and layout of your kitchen when selecting a built-in ceramic cooktop. A model that complements the existing décor can greatly enhance the overall look and feel of the space. For instance, minimalist designs may suit modern kitchens, while classic finishes may better fit traditional settings.

Additionally, prospective buyers should consider the size of the cooktop in relation to their cooking needs. Options vary from compact models perfect for smaller kitchens to expansive units ideal for avid cooks who often prepare large meals. Reviewing product specifications and user reviews can assist in making an informed choice that meets your culinary requirements.
